<p>After surviving a stage-four cancer diagnosis, Kate Bowler knew she was supposed to be grateful. Alive. Blessed. But she still ached &#8211; for more connection, more surprise, less resentment on an ordinary day. So she went looking for joy. Not the toxic positivity kind. Not a five-step plan. But the type that sneaks in unexpectedly, seemingly out of nowhere. </p>
<p>In <i>Joyful, Anyway</i>, Bowler takes us on a hilarious and tender journey through big questions and small delights. With wry wit and deep honesty, she explores how joy can surprise us even in the middle of pain, boredom and longing.</p>
<p>This is not a book about fixing your life. It is about how we can all find more and feel more, by making room for small extraordinary moments. <p>As a professor of financial economics Neeltje van Horen excelled in a demanding career &#8211; but constant self-doubt and stress left her feeling stuck. Seeking a way out, she turned to neuroscience and psychology and discovered how retraining her brain &#8211; one small habit at a time &#8211; transformed her life.</p>
<p>In Ignite, van Horen shares her journey and her discoveries. Blending relatable stories, cutting-edge research and practical strategies, she reveals how small, intentional changes can deliver meaningful results. Recognising that everyone&#8217;s path is unique, she offers a range of techniques, helping you discover what aligns best with your needs and aspirations.</p>

					<description><![CDATA[After losing multiple contracts, Shuichi must make restitution to his company. Faced with this large, unanticipated debt, the trip to Paris he and his wife have been planning for a year must be cancelled. Travelling to Europe was more than a vacation; it offered the hope of reaching their teenage daughter who has stopped going to school and will not leave her room. Feeling despondent and directionless, Shuichi believes he's the unluckiest person in Japan. Then a strange taxi mysteriously appears at his door. The driver promises to take Shuichi not to a destination he needs, but to where his next opportunity will be. With nothing to lose, he settles into the backseat and embarks on a series of magical rides that will teach him surprising life lessons, including how luck is not inherent - it's an investment built over time and even over generations.]]></description>
